What You'll Be Doing:

  • Deliver targeted support in History, Geography and RE lessons
  • Help design and run engaging, interactive Humanities workshops and clubs
  • Provide one-to-one and small group academic interventions
  • Assist teachers with creative lesson planning and resource development
  • Track student progress and deliver feedback that sparks improvement
  • Actively nurture curiosity and critical thinking throughout the school
